WDM SFP Transceiver with APD Receiver
FWDM-1619-7D-xx
PRODUCT FEATURES
Up to 1.25 Gb/s data links
Hot-pluggable SFP footprint
Built- in digital diagnostic functions
Uncooled DFB laser transmitter in
8 CWDM wavelengths
APD Receiver
Very low jitter
Metal enclosure, for lower EMI
Single 3.3V power supply
Operating temperature range: 0°C
to 70°C
APPLICATIONS
Metro Access Rings and Point-to-Point
networking for Gigabit Ethernet and
Fibre Channel
Finisar’s FWDM-1619-7D-xx CWDM Small Form Factor Pluggable (SFP) transceivers
are designed for operation in Metro Access Rings and Point-to-Point networks using
Gigabit Ethernet and Fibre Channel networking equipment. They are available in eight
different CWDM wavelengt hs. Digital diagnostics functions are available via an I
2
C
serial bus. In addition, they comply with the Small Form Factor Pluggable Multi-
Sourcing Agreement (MSA)
1
.
